Well after flogging her Ibiza Cupra TDi to some gullible wee lad from the country, @browne174, we started looking for a bigger car.
This Leon FR popped up in Irvingstown from the same chap @Deemc got his Yellow colour collection from a thouroughly bloody nice bloke. After two 94 mile trips there and back we agreed a price and drove home with it.
It's a PD170 and it's going to remain standard powerwise due to the slightly more volatile nature of this engine with regards to DPF issues, so I don't want to tempt fate.
It's loads more comfortable than the Ibiza's rock solid suspension and handling is great with seat that actually bolster you in place. The cabin, despite my negative view to the person that designed the center console having the design skills of a chimp with a paintbrush, has grown on me highly and will look great once I pop an RNS unit of some description in there down the line.
Its had the upgraded Andromeda wheels, Auto dim rear mirror, dual climate, auto lights and wipers, and a few other niceties that make it a pleasure to drive and i's surprisingly fun with a lively rear end and very positive/predictive handling.
I've not given it a full clean yet as with moving house over the last few weeks and being a lazy *******. But I have managed to take the sandpaper to a few scratches out of it and managed to remove 90% of them to a standard im happy enough with.
